<p>Mark Chapman, World Cup winner Cesc Fabregas, former Manchester City defender Nedum Onuoha, and Statman Dave react to the week’s Champions League action and talk all things Premier League. We discuss Jadon Sancho, whose performance for Borussia Dortmund was praised after a difficult couple of seasons at parent club, Manchester United. Cesc, Nedum and ... Show More
